Commit Graph

45 Commits

Author SHA1 Message Date
stuebinm
ff1a94e523 treewide: add meta.mainProgram to packages with a single binary
The nixpkgs-unstable channel's programs.sqlite was used to identify
packages producing exactly one binary, and these automatically added
to their package definitions wherever possible.
2024-03-19 03:14:51 +01:00
R. Ryantm
9726ab03eb gqrx: 2.17.3 -> 2.17.4 2024-02-10 11:45:00 +01:00
R. Ryantm
4e9938a45f gqrx: 2.17.2 -> 2.17.3 2023-10-30 04:21:43 +00:00
R. Ryantm
2ebcdae4fe gqrx-gr-audio: 2.17 -> 2.17.2 2023-10-10 17:39:26 +00:00
R. Ryantm
c07a364d2d gqrx-portaudio: 2.16 -> 2.17 2023-10-06 15:50:54 -07:00
R. Ryantm
0270282327 gqrx: 2.15.10 -> 2.16 2023-04-30 11:58:58 +02:00
Doron Behar
cf7db74bf4 gqrx: Use latest gnuradio 2023-04-21 13:11:49 +03:00
Doron Behar
2634268fa6 gnuradio: Define a common logLib attribute
Use it in all gnuradio modules.
2023-04-21 13:11:49 +03:00
Doron Behar
ab6c85f31c gqrx: 2.15.9 -> 2.15.10
Diff: https://github.com/gqrx-sdr/gqrx/compare/v2.15.9...v2.15.10
2023-04-14 19:29:02 +03:00
QuantMint
2249e45a40 gqrx: build with qt6 2023-01-10 17:30:23 +01:00
Bjørn Forsman
8f254b8107 gqrx: add wrapGAppsHook
Fixes saving settings on non-NixOS systems ("No GSettings schemas are
installed on the system").

Fix https://github.com/NixOS/nixpkgs/issues/173848.
2022-05-21 12:56:23 +02:00
R. Ryantm
d123a1a575 gqrx: 2.15.8 -> 2.15.9 2022-04-11 20:58:12 +02:00
Doron Behar
88519c6309 gnuradio: Inherit log dependencies in passthrus
Inherit spdlog for GR 3.10 and log4cpp for lower GR versions. Inherit
both of these in the scope of the GR packages attribute set. Also use
the inherited log4cpp in qradiolink, gqrx & gnss-sdr.
2022-02-18 10:53:48 +02:00
R. Ryantm
be18a18cc0 gqrx: 2.15.7 -> 2.15.8 2022-02-12 20:56:35 -08:00
Nikolay Korotkiy
65705a8341
gqrx: 2.15.4 → 2.15.7 2022-01-23 22:19:35 +03:00
Nikolay Korotkiy
d18d62d487 gqrx: 2.15.2 → 2.15.4 2022-01-17 00:18:27 +01:00
R. Ryantm
a41b0b4b94 gqrx: 2.15.1 -> 2.15.2 2022-01-11 18:41:07 +01:00
R. Ryantm
0c5eaa41c1 gqrx: 2.15 -> 2.15.1 2021-12-30 14:46:20 +00:00
Nikolay Korotkiy
01d5310c19 gqrx: 2.14.6 → 2.15 2021-12-15 22:45:28 +01:00
Astro
3745b58ace gqrx: update support for different audio backends 2021-12-03 18:33:30 +01:00
R. Ryantm
5d0d7b120f gqrx: 2.14.4 -> 2.14.6 2021-10-29 21:02:21 +00:00
Doron Behar
58025e8587 gnuradio: Reenable thrift support
Apparently, this requires thrift to be added to all other reverse
dependencies.
2021-10-23 23:46:45 +03:00
AndersonTorres
e9e5f5f84d Change all alsaLib references to alsa-lib 2021-06-10 01:12:49 -03:00
Doron Behar
fb024f50e5 gnuradio: 3.8 -> 3.9
Add some "3.9" attributes to srcs in gnuradio packages And update
packages using GR3.8 and that are incompatible yet with GR3.9 to use
GR3.8 explicitly.
2021-03-13 19:07:34 +02:00
Doron Behar
99c3bdb9b6 gqrx: Refactor to use gnuradioMinimal.pkgs.mkDerivation
- Use gnuradio's `mkDerivation` which includes most of the deps needed.
- Always enable pulseaudio support as that's part of gnuradio's deps
anyway.
- Use gnuradioMinimal.pkgs.osmosdr - not from the alias gr-osmosdr.
2021-03-13 12:47:00 +02:00
Pavol Rusnak
a6ce00c50c
treewide: remove stdenv where not needed 2021-01-25 18:31:47 +01:00
R. RyanTM
20f929a787 gqrx: 2.14.3 -> 2.14.4 2021-01-18 23:28:25 +00:00
Ben Siraphob
108bdac3d9 pkgs/applications: stdenv.lib -> lib 2021-01-15 14:24:03 +07:00
Profpatsch
4a7f99d55d treewide: with stdenv.lib; in meta -> with lib;
Part of: https://github.com/NixOS/nixpkgs/issues/108938

meta = with stdenv.lib;

is a widely used pattern. We want to slowly remove
the `stdenv.lib` indirection and encourage people
to use `lib` directly. Thus let’s start with the meta
field.

This used a rewriting script to mostly automatically
replace all occurances of this pattern, and add the
`lib` argument to the package header if it doesn’t
exist yet.

The script in its current form is available at
https://cs.tvl.fyi/depot@2f807d7f141068d2d60676a89213eaa5353ca6e0/-/blob/users/Profpatsch/nixpkgs-rewriter/default.nix
2021-01-11 10:38:22 +01:00
Ben Siraphob
3ae5e6ce03 treewide: remove enableParallelBuilding = true if using cmake 2021-01-03 18:37:40 +07:00
R. RyanTM
7c601e15e5 gqrx: 2.14.2 -> 2.14.3 2020-12-10 17:14:46 +00:00
Eduardo Sánchez Muñoz
2959bb7028 gqrx: fix icon
The icon is a single file, so it should be placed in `pixmaps` instead of `icons`.
2020-12-09 19:58:42 +01:00
R. RyanTM
c8a1fd6e39 gqrx: 2.14 -> 2.14.2 2020-12-05 19:31:40 +00:00
R. RyanTM
3e3306f6d9 gqrx: 2.13.5 -> 2.14 2020-11-21 23:15:07 +00:00
R. RyanTM
855fc08b1b gqrx: 2.13.2 -> 2.13.5 2020-11-11 14:35:31 -08:00
R. RyanTM
3ff7bf9166 gqrx: 2.13 -> 2.13.2 2020-10-27 08:55:38 +01:00
R. RyanTM
90b1417a1d gqrx: 2.12.1 -> 2.13 2020-10-18 10:45:23 +00:00
Jörg Thalheim
887295fd2d
treewide: remove the-kenny from maintainers
@the-kenny did a good job in the past and is set as maintainer in many package,
however since 2017-2018 he stopped contributing. To create less confusion
in pull requests when people try to request his feedback, I removed him as
maintainer from all packages.
2020-05-09 10:28:57 +01:00
Patrick Hilhorst
5b49816cf4
treewide: add quotes to recently-changed urls
Co-Authored-By: Drew <drewrisinger@users.noreply.github.com>
2020-03-28 00:05:50 +01:00
Patrick Hilhorst
9fc5e7e473
treewide: fix redirected urls (again)
Ran the same script as #78265.
Additionally, manually replaced `http://goodies.xfce.org`
with https.
2020-03-20 13:36:23 +01:00
R. RyanTM
71db54a01f gqrx: 2.11.5 -> 2.12.1 2020-01-31 23:14:55 +00:00
volth
46420bbaa3 treewide: name -> pname (easy cases) (#66585)
treewide replacement of

stdenv.mkDerivation rec {
  name = "*-${version}";
  version = "*";

to pname
2019-08-15 13:41:18 +01:00
Bjørn Forsman
a26168ff46 gqrx: use qt5's mkDerivation
Fixes

  qt.qpa.plugin: Could not find the Qt platform plugin "xcb" in ""
  This application failed to start because no Qt platform plugin could be initialized. Reinstalling the application may fix this problem.

See https://github.com/NixOS/nixpkgs/issues/65399
2019-08-07 20:40:02 +02:00
Markus Kowalewski
069167de8a
gnuradio: rename plugins gnuradio-* -> gr-*
* harmonize plugin names with repology
* added aliases to maintain backwards compatability
2019-05-27 14:26:31 +02:00
Elis Hirwing
96339a1a9c
gqrx: Move from misc to radio 2019-02-09 21:38:47 +01:00